Skills and Competencies

 

  • Full-Stack Development Expertise: 10+ years of experience in Python, JavaScript, HTML, and CSS, with strong proficiency in both front-end (React, Angular) and back-end (Django, FastAPI, Flask) frameworks.
  • Generative AI & ML: Hands-on experience building and deploying Agentic AI solutions (e.g., chatbots, enterprise assistants) using tools like FastMCP, Azure AI Search
  • Cloud & Architecture: Skilled in designing cloud-based solutions across AWS, Azure, and GCP, with experience in containerization (Docker), DevOps pipelines, and version control (Git)., LangSmith, LangChain, OpenAI API, and custom LLMs; familiarity with ML frameworks, NLP techniques, and MLOps workflows.
  • Database & Data Management: Proficient in SQL (PostgreSQL, MySQL) and NoSQL (DynamoDB, Cosmos DB) systems; experienced in auditing and resolving data quality issues.
  • Testing & Security: Strong understanding of secure coding practices, authentication, and encryption; experienced with AI testing frameworks like LangSmith and Langfuse as well as code testing frameworks like Pytest, Cypress, and Jest.
  • Collaboration & Leadership: Excellent communication and team management skills; proven ability to lead cross-functional teams and deliver AI-powered solutions that drive business value.
  • Adaptability & Problem Solving: Highly detail-oriented with strong problem-solving skills; thrives in fast-paced environments and consistently meets deadlines.

 

 

Education

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related field.

 

 

Responsibilities

  • Lead full-stack application development, integrating Python backends with modern front-end frameworks, and deploying solutions on AWS, Azure, and GCP.
  • Design and implement enterprise-grade Generative AI solutions, including LLM-based chatbots and domain-specific assistants aligned with business goals.
  • Develop collaborative apps on platforms like Microsoft Teams and Viva, enhancing user engagement and productivity.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with product, business, operations, and design teams to align technical solutions with user needs and strategic objectives.
  • Write secure, reusable, and testable code, enforce best practices, and participate in code reviews to maintain high-quality standards.
  • Mentor and guide developers, lead team discussions, and manage GitHub repositories to support team growth and project continuity.
  • Communicate technical concepts effectively to leadership and stakeholders, while staying current with emerging technologies and tools.

 

 

About The Team

AVP Software Engineer will lead our team in developing and maintaining complex web applications. The ideal candidate should have extensive experience in building enterprise capable back-end and front-end development using Python, as well as strong leadership and communication skills. In this role, you will be responsible for guiding and mentoring other developers, collaborating with designers to implement user-friendly interfaces, and ensuring the quality and scalability of our applications.
